The cost of changing your windows into French doors can range from $600 to $5800, based on the dimensions the style, design, and material. It is also possible to extend the opening, which can add to costs.
A permit is required to make an opening in your wall, so that's one expense to take into consideration. The size and value of your home determines the cost.

To increase energy efficiency, it is a good idea to install triple or double-glazed doors with low-e glass. This will prevent cool or hot air from venting out and will reduce solar heat gain. In addition, you may decide to install an infill of gas between the glass panels in order to improve energy efficiency.
It is also important to consider whether you'll need new headers for your French Doors. It is not typically required however, you should make sure to check the local building codes.
It is also important to consider the cost of any additional materials you need for example, new insulation and the trim package. The costs will vary based on the style of French doors you choose. Make sure to obtain a an exact estimate from your contractor prior to starting work.

Stucco can be shaped in any way to match the architecture of your house. Stucco is a mixture of cement, sand, lime, and water. It's strong and lasts for a long time if properly installed. But stucco is a highly skilled expertise, and isn't something you can usually do by yourself.
If you opt for a more decorative style of siding, like brick or stucco, you'll need to hire a professional to do the work. They're not as weatherproof as wood or composite and will require more maintenance.
It is important to understand that replacing a French door window will require a new frame for your doorway. This means you'll need include a header to help support the weight of the doors as well as any walls above them.
